  • Here is a sample of the many shells and seaweed we found at Fort Foster at the mouth of the Piscataqua river that divides New Hampshire and Maine. It's a lovely place for a walk or beach combing. (Although keep in mind I do not believe we are allowed to take anything from the area - except of course trash and sea glass.) There is a little playground for the kids and many sights for the history buff.
